The Strategic Centre for African Affairs head has paid a courtesy call to International Human Rights Commission (IHRC) Africa Ambassador at his Westland office in Accra.
The Abdel Moneim Boussifita and Abu Zein's discussion centred on the 32 Arab League Summit currently underway in Jeddah, Saudi Arabia with emphasis on the recent Tripoli crisis.
The summit seeks to bridge all differences including those within Libya and the Arab Region as a whole
And the duo were expecting a strong closing statement that will eliminate problems in the region on the Summit.
Abdel Moneim Boussifita underscored the need for unity among Arab countries in order to overcome mutual challenges and difficulties among members.

In like manner, Abu Zein, who is also the chairman of African Gateway FX Limited Group expressed optimism that the summit will bring lasting solutions to all the affected nations.
He sympathised with nations and individuals in the region whose fundamental human rights are trampled on and expressed the wish that the summit will find solutions for that.
The Libyan Assets Recovery and Management Office (LARMO) and Strategic Centre for African Affairs have authorised Abu Zein to initiate contacts, communications, and correspondence with institutions, persons, entities, deemed to have possessed information on assets belonging to the Libyan state of any nature.
The 32nd Pan- Arab League summit brings together 22 member countries and five observer nations in Saudi Arabia’s coastal town.
The multi-nation meeting comes at a time when various geo-political developments are impacting the grouping’s members, including the ongoing situation in Sudan, the Russia-Ukraine crisis, and Syria’s readmission to the body.
